What is Exculpate?
1.
To free from blame or guilt.
Pronunciation: 'ek-(,)skul-,pât,
Inflected forms: ex·cul·pat·ed; ex·cul·pat·ing; ex·cul·pa·tion
"Hey man, is that Tommy? I thought he went to jail for robbing that liquor store."
"Nah man, someone else confessed to that. Tommy was exculpated."
